Python Level 2: Problem Solver

พัฒนาการเขียนโค้ดด้วยการสร้างแบล็คแจ็คและเกมอื่นๆ ในหลักสูตรนี้ ผู้เรียนจะแก้ปัญหาการเขียนโปรแกรมที่ซับซ้อนมากขึ้นและดำเนินการผ่านพื้นฐานของ Python พวกเขากำลังไปสู่ความคล่องแคล่วของ Python หลักสูตรแบบ 1:1 นี้มีการวางแผนบทเรียนเฉพาะบุคคล
ทดลองเรียนฟรี
Private 1:1
รูปแบบ
Age 11-18
อายุ
ทุกอาทิตย์
ตาราง
50 นาที
เวลาเรียน
เกี่ยวกับเกี่ยวกับคอร์ส
Python 1 เป็นหลักสูตรการเขียนโค้ดหลักของ WeStride เราได้สอนนักเรียนหลายพันคนเกี่ยวกับพื้นฐานของ Python เช่น ไวยากรณ์ ลูป เงื่อนไข และฟังก์ชันผ่านโปรเจ็กต์ที่ใช้กราฟิกที่น่าตื่นเต้น เมื่อจบหลักสูตร นักเรียนจะสร้างโปรเจกต์ระดับสุดยอดและสามารถแชร์กับเพื่อนและครอบครัวใน Community ได้!
ทดลองเรียนฟรี
เกี่ยวกับเกี่ยวกับคอร์ส

ราคา

฿2500/เดือน
4 classes / month × ฿625 / class

ตารางเรียน

ชั้นเรียนแบบ 1:1 มีความยาว 50 นาที และสามารถกำหนดเวลาได้ตลอดเวลาในวันจันทร์-อาทิตย์ เวลา 7.00 น. ถึง 19.00 น. สามารถเลือก ลองคลาสฟรี เพื่อสมัคร จากนั้นทีมของเราจะจับคู่คุณและจัดคลาสแรกของคุณให้!

หัวข้อการเรียน

Variables
  • I know what a variable is and when to use a variable in my code
  • I can create a variable and assign it a value in Python
  • I can print out a variable in Python
  • I understand the difference between a string and an integer
  • I can use the str() function correctly in Python
  • I can ask for user input in Python
  • I can use the len() function correctly in Python
  • I can access the ith character in a string in Python
  • I can concatenate strings in Python
Loops
  • I know what a loop is and when to use a loop in my code
  • I know the difference between a for loop and a while loop and when to use each in my code
  • I can write a for loop in Python using 'for i in range():' syntax
  • I can use a for loop in Python to access characters in a string
  • I can write a for loop in Python with a specified starting point, ending point, and increment
  • I can write a while loop in Python
  • I can use a while loop in Python to access characters in a string
  • I understand when and how to use a while True loop in Python
Conditionals
  • I know what a conditional statement is
  • I can write an 'if' statement in Python
  • I can use 'and' statements logically to check multiple conditions in Python
  • I can use 'or' statements logically to check multiple conditions in Python
  • I understand how and when to use 'elif' statements in Python
  • I understand how and when to use 'else' statements in Python
  • I can write nested 'if' statements in Python
Functions
  • I understand what functions are and what they are used for
  • I can define a function in Python using parameters as necessary
  • I can define a function with an output in Python
  • I can call a function in Python, specifying parameters where necessary
  • I can use the output of a function in my code in Python
Lists
  • I know what a list is and when to use a list in code
  • I can create an empty list in Python
  • I can use the append() and remove() functions correctly with lists in Python
  • I can access and interact with each item in a list in Python
  • I can iterate through a list in Python
  • I can add items to a list using a loop in Python
Dictionaries
  • I understand what a dictionary is
  • I can create a dictionary in Python
  • I can access a value in a dictionary in Python
  • I can add a key-value pair to a dictionary in Python
  • I can iterate through a dictionary in Python
  • I can check whether an item exists in a dictionary in Python
  • I can add items to a dictionary using a loop in Python
Nested Loops
  • I understand when to use nested loops
  • I can write a nested loop in Python
  • I understand what each loop in the nested loops controls
  • I understand which loop to add code to, to get the result I want
  • I can determine how many times a line of code in a nested loop runs
Game Mechanics
  • I understand when and how to use a while True loop in Python
  • I understand what a break statement does in Python
Lists
  • I know what a list is and when to use a list in code
  • I can create an empty list in Python
  • I can use the append() function correctly with lists in Python
  • I can iterate through a list in Python
  • I can access and interact with each item in a list in Python
Sets
  • I understand what a set is
  • I can create an empty set in Python
  • I can use the add() and remove() functions correctly with sets in Python
  • I can use the union() function correctly in Python
  • I can use the intersection() function correctly in Python
  • I can check whether an item exists in a set in Python
  • I can add items to a set using a loop in Python

การบ้าน

ผู้สอนจะมอบหมายการบ้านที่เกี่ยวข้องกับโครงการให้นักเรียนประมาณ 60 นาทีเมื่อสิ้นสุดแต่ละเซสชัน การบ้านได้รับการออกแบบมาเพื่อเสริมประสบการณ์ในชั้นเรียนและทำให้แน่ใจว่านักเรียนยังคงได้รับประสบการณ์ภาคปฏิบัตินอกคาบเรียน
Python 2 เปิดโอกาสให้นักเรียนใช้ความรู้กับปัญหาการเขียนโค้ทที่ซับซ้อนมากขึ้น เมื่อจบหลักสูตร นักเรียนจะรู้สึกสบายใจและมั่นใจในการใช้การเข้ารหัส set, conditional statements และ dictionaries เพื่อแก้ปัญหาการเขียนโค้ดที่ยากขึ้น ด้วยคำแนะนำจากผู้สอน WeStride นักเรียนจะสร้างโปรเจคที่น่าตื่นเต้น เช่น เครื่องคิดเลขของตนเอง และเกมแบล็คแจ็คเสมือนจริง เป็นต้น
ทดลองเรียนฟรี

ทดลองเรียนฟรี

ขอบคุณ! ได้รับการส่งของคุณแล้ว! เราจะติดต่อคุณภายใน 1 วันทำการ
Oops! Something went wrong while submitting the form.